IP查询
查询
你查询的IP:[60.63.229.94] 地理位置:中国–上海–上海电信/东方有线
最新查询
117.32.54.33
58.30.185.222
61.232.6.172
116.76.176.156
210.72.165.175
61.48.129.175
117.60.105.210
220.192.49.110
116.8.32.81
60.63.229.94
202.20.120.230
117.64.159.48
202.127.212.196
124.72.134.2
116.212.160.128
222.176.174.191
122.51.5.138
202.127.48.90
220.248.249.10
210.185.192.220
124.6.64.85
125.210.180.63
59.64.150.192
61.4.80.93
202.91.245.247
125.61.128.47
202.38.146.126
116.192.177.181
121.55.25.82
203.130.32.108
203.110.160.163